ed 3, 30 CANTERBURY FLOUR MILLS. ASHBURTON. NOTICE’ TO Farmers and others rjIHE BUSINESS OF THE ABOVE MILLS will for the future be Managed oil my behalf by my Son, Mb. C. HARCOURT TURNER AND Mr, DAVID H. BROWh Who will be prepared to PURCHASE WHEAT of GOOD QUALITY at the HIGHEST MARKET RATES THE CANTERBURY MILLS hare been RE-FITTED THROUGHOUT with all the recent MANUFACTURING, IMPROVEMENT adopted in Continental Europe and in America, including the CHILLED IRON ROLLER SYSTEM The WHEAT CLEANING MACHINERY is not surpassed in New Zealand. The quality of the LOUR from -these MILLS should therefore command the the immediate attention of the Trade generally. ONE EXPERIMENTAL ORDER from Bakers is invited, in perfect confi dence that it will be followed by regular demands for the Flour FARMERS’ GRISTS Will receive prompt and oarefj attention. WH EAT SPECIALLY OLE AN fob FARMERS FOB Seed Purposes. For particulars apply at the MiL To Me D. H. BROWN To Mb C. HARCOURT TURNER Offices, Saunders’s Buildings, Ashburton: Or to C. W. TURNER, CASHEL STREET Christchurch. N.B. —Mb Samuel Saundebs, who . the last two years has represented me Ashburton, retires from the appointman as from this date. Christchurch 11th Feb., I£B4
